The PSPV accuses the PP of "attacking the Valencian and the AVL" and of "insubordination to the Statute"

The PSPV-PSOE has issued a statement in which it denounces "the unprecedented attack on Valencian and the legal insubordination in linguistic matters in which the Consell del PP Y VOX has installed itself". The deputy José Chulvi, who signs the statement, criticizes that the PP "has bought Vox's anti-Valencian agenda" and "disregards the hallmarks of Valencians." "The first thing to do is comply with the Statute of Autonomy and with the institutions that emanate from it, such as the Valencian Academy of Language."

The PSPV accusation refers to the statements by the Minister of Education, José Antonio Rovira, in which he assessed this morning that the Valencian Academy of Language, AVL, "does not have the absolute truth about Valencian as no one else does" , and has defended that "everyone use the Valencian they deem appropriate". He said this when asked about the statements by former president Eduardo Zaplana in this newspaper in which he defended the validity of the entity he created in 1998. In this regard, the minister added that he does not see the possibility of using "other regulations" outside the statutory entity.

Chulvi has highlighted that "it seems incredible that a black-legged Zaplanista like Rovira questions the authority of the Valencian Academy of Language; for something from Zaplana that his political heirs would have to copy, they don't." In this sense, Chulvi has also remarked that "the only one to blame for this nonsense is Carlos Mazón" because "the first thing a government has to do is comply with the law": "They send society a message of enormous responsibility."

Lastly, the socialist leader stressed that "the lack of respect of the Consell towards the Valencian cannot be allowed, disseminating messages through official channels with texts full of misspellings, offering a very regrettable image that is intended to be attack the defense and protection of our language"
